    Job overview

    As a Clinical Psychologist or Cognitive Behavioural Psychotherapist, you will:

  • Be responsible for providing community-based specialist psychological input for a range of different eating disorders.
  • Work as part of a specialist multidisciplinary team for adults with a range of eating disorders.
  • Work autonomously within professional guidelines and Trust and Service policies and procedures.
  • Utilise theoretical knowledge and clinical skills to support clients towards recovery.
  • Utilise research skills for audit and support service development.
  • This post is part of an expansion of the current service towards developing a comprehensive eating disorders services as part of the local implementation plan.

    The Eating Disorders team would welcome applications from newly qualified candidates

    Working for our organisation

    We are a well-established eating disorder service looking for a dynamic enthusiastic Clinical Psychologist or Cognitive Behavioural Psychotherapist.

    The DHCFT eating disorder service was established in 7 and is an expanding service which covers the City of Derby and the County of Derbyshire providing a high-quality community service.

    Therapeutic interventions are provided to clients and their families and consultation and advice are offered to a wide range of staff.

    The team currently consists of 2 Psychiatrists, 4 Clinical Psychologists, 3 Nurse Therapists, 2 Occupational Therapists, a Dietitian and Administrators.

    The team currently delivers a range of therapeutic interventions from CBT-E, Mantra, RO-DBT, and Psychodynamic and Systemically informed approaches interventions are delivered both individually and in Group settings.

    There are many opportunities to work jointly with MDT colleagues.

    Qualified Clinical Psychologists and 3rd year Clinical Psychology Trainees are welcome to apply. Cognitive Behavioural Psychotherapists will be required to have a core profession, such as Nursing, Occupational Therapy or Social Work.

    The Trust recognises the value of training you will be encouraged to develop additional skills in working with this client group and you'll be invited to attend the eight-day national eating disordered trainee training run by the Maudsley hospital.

    The service also works in partnership with a third sector provider to deliver practical interventions to clients and their carers to support clinical interventions. In addition, the service has a close working relationship with other eating disorder services, specialist inpatient services, gastroenterology and diabetes services.

    In addition, the team works closely with the CAMHS eating disorders services to ensure good transitions of care.
